Does Amazon hire testers?

Amazon does not officially hire product testers as a regular employee role. However, they sometimes work with third-party companies or independent reviewers to evaluate products, and individuals can participate in testing programs or review opportunities through various platforms. These roles often require attention to detail and familiarity with Amazon products or services.

How do I become a paid product tester for Amazon?

To become a paid product tester for Amazon, you can sign up for Amazon's Vine program or participate in third-party product testing platforms that partner with Amazon. These programs often require you to have an active Amazon account, provide honest reviews, and sometimes complete profile surveys to match you with suitable products.

What are Part Time Amazon Product Testers?

Part Time Amazon Product Testers are individuals who receive products from Amazon sellers or brands in exchange for testing and providing feedback or reviews. They typically work on a flexible schedule, evaluating new or existing products and sharing their honest opinions. This role helps companies improve their products and understand customer preferences. Testers may receive free products or small compensation, but legitimate programs never require upfront payments. It is important to be cautious of scams and only participate through reputable channels.
